Neighborhood Overview
Waterville Junior High School is situated in the heart of Waterville, a mid-sized city in central Maine, along the picturesque banks of the Kennebec River. Its location on West River Road provides convenient access from major thoroughfares. The primary access route for those coming from out of state or longer distances is Interstate 95, which is a short drive away, connecting north to Bangor and south to Augusta and Portland. From I-95, take Exit 132 (Waterville) and follow signs toward downtown Waterville, then head towards West River Road. Local roads, such as Main Street and Bridge Street, also feed into the school's vicinity. Parking is available on campus, with specific areas designated for events and general use; arriving early is recommended, especially on game days or during school events, to secure a good spot and avoid traffic congestion on West River Road. For those utilizing public transportation or rideshare services, Waterville has a limited bus system, and rideshare availability is generally good within the city limits. The nearest major airport is Portland International Jetport (PWM), located about an hour and a half to two hours south via I-95, while Augusta State Airport (AUG) is closer but has fewer flight options.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Waterville is characterized by cold temperatures, with daytime highs often hovering around freezing and nighttime lows dipping significantly below. Expect snow, which can impact travel and outdoor activities, so dress in layers with warm coats, hats, and gloves. Indoor venues like the school gymnasium or nearby libraries become primary gathering spots. Allow extra travel time due to potential snow or icy conditions on roads.
Spring & early summer
Spring weather in Waterville is variable, transitioning from chilly to mild. Early spring can still bring frost, while late spring and early summer (May-June) offer pleasant temperatures perfect for outdoor activities. Light jackets or sweaters are usually sufficient for cooler evenings, while daytime can be quite comfortable. This is an excellent time for visiting attractions without the peak summer crowds.
Mid-summer
July and August are typically the warmest months, with daytime temperatures often in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it, occasionally reaching into the 90s. Humidity can make it feel warmer. Casual, lightweight clothing is recommended. Staying hydrated is important, and seeking out air-conditioned spaces or shaded park areas during the hottest parts of the day is advisable. Outdoor events are most comfortable in the morning or late afternoon.
Fall season
Fall in Waterville, from September through November, offers crisp air and beautiful foliage. Temperatures gradually cool, starting pleasantly mild and becoming quite chilly by late autumn. Layers are essential, including sweaters and light jackets, with warmer outerwear needed by November. This season is excellent for enjoying the outdoors before winter sets in, with comfortable conditions for walking and exploring.
Rain & snow
Rain is possible year-round in Waterville, with heavier periods often occurring in spring and fall. Snowfall is common from late November through March. Visitors should always pack a rain jacket or umbrella, and waterproof boots are highly recommended during the wetter and snowier months. Weather can change quickly, so checking forecasts before heading out for any event or activity is a wise precaution.
